Transaction 05a1f042061c7a49c4200b66757c2165236d28cd4fcc60b7c670f9241ee828ef

block
d585e5b6a88ce424fe00abaecb2f19bcdf214951d4c2b0e6205faf6fe3b5ae93

1 Input

21 Outputs